Artist: BluegrassReport.org


Confronting Bodies: state of Kentucky


Dates of Action: 20 June 2006


Location: Kentucky, U.S.A.


Description of Artwork: Political watchdog site BluegrassReport.org

The Incident: BluegrassReport.org has apparently been blocked to state computers by the Commonwealth Office of Technology. Readers in three different cabinets have e-mailed to say they get a "blocked" message when they try to access the site.

Results of Incident: Still blocked. National media attention being garnered.
